Output 766460bdedc53d98e5201007894a6867662706823648691c7e99869632028909:1

value
56698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5224f894b208d3cb671649a95c5e493a94457b6 OP_EQUAL
address
3Q3AaVQoJ8miaqq6iwCK6MT37NAyMRj9PD
transaction
766460bdedc53d98e5201007894a6867662706823648691c7e99869632028909
spent
true